Ubuntu Docker桥接删除
在使用Docker时,我们经常会需要进行网络配置,其中桥接网络是最常见的网络模式之一。然而,有时候我们需要删除已经创建的桥接网络。本文将介绍如何在Ubuntu系统上删除Docker桥接网络,并提供相应的代码示例。
Docker桥接网络简介
在Docker中,桥接网络是一种网络模式,它使得容器可以相互通信,同时也可以与主机进行通信。当我们创建一个Docker容器时,默认会创建一个桥接网络来连接这个容器。这样,容器之间和容器与主机之间就可以互相通信了。
删除Docker桥接网络步骤
要删除Docker桥接网络,可以按照以下步骤进行:
- 首先,查看当前存在的桥接网络,可以使用以下命令:
docker network ls
这会列出所有当前存在的Docker网络。
- 找到要删除的桥接网络,可以使用以下命令:
docker network inspect <network_name>
这会显示有关指定桥接网络的详细信息,包括连接到该网络的容器等。
- 删除桥接网络,可以使用以下命令:
docker network rm <network_name>
这会删除指定的桥接网络。
示例
接下来,我们通过一个示例来演示如何删除一个名为my_network
的桥接网络。
- 首先,查看当前存在的网络:
docker network ls
应该会看到名为my_network
的网络。
- 查看
my_network
网络的详细信息:
docker network inspect my_network
这会显示有关my_network
网络的详细信息。
- 删除
my_network
网络:
docker network rm my_network
这会删除my_network
网络。
状态图
下面是一个简单的状态图,展示了删除Docker桥接网络的过程:
stateDiagram
[*] --> 查看当前网络: docker network ls
查看当前网络 --> 查看网络详细信息: docker network inspect <network_name>
查看网络详细信息 --> 删除网络: docker network rm <network_name>
删除网络 --> [*]
总结
通过本文,我们了解了如何在Ubuntu系统上删除Docker桥接网络的步骤,并提供了相应的代码示例。删除桥接网络可以帮助我们清理不再需要的网络,保持系统整洁。希望这篇文章对您有所帮助!